For the month of December 2011, patient charges at Northfield Hospital (a not-for-profit hospital) were $2,720,000. Third-party payors were billed $1,800,000.
The hospital estimated that contractual adjustments would reduce the amount collected from third-party payors to $1,710,000.
Required:
Prepare the necessary journal entry to record the contractual adjustments.
